Sophie Skelton

Sophie Skelton

Born in Woodford in the Cheshire region of the U.K., actress Sophie Skelton was the youngest of three children. Both of her parents invented toys for a living. Skelton elected to put off college in favor of pursuing a career as an actress. Skelton's television debut came in 2012 when she played Becca Smith in two episodes of the TV series "DCI Banks" (ITV 2010-). In 2013 Skelton played the role of Esme Vasquez-Jones in the television series "The Dumping Ground" (CBBC 2013-). In 2013 and 2014, Skelton appeared as Eve Boston in four episodes of the series "Waterloo Road" (BBC 2006-2015). In 2015 Skelton was cast as Sofia Matthews in the television series "So Awkward" (CBBC 2015-). She appeared in 13 episodes of the series which followed the lives of three socially awkward teenagers in high school. In 2016 Skelton appeared as the title character in the television miniseries "Ren," a fantasy story about a girl given powers by an ancient spirit. It 2016 it was announced that Skelton would be cast in the role of Brianna in the Starz Original series "Outlander" (Starz 2014-), which follows the story of an Englishwoman who travels through time.
